What Probate Could Cost Your Family

Without a plan, California law takes over. The costs to your family can be staggering.

$30K+

High Fees

California probate fees are set by statute based on gross estate value. For a modest home, attorney and executor fees alone can exceed $30,000, calculated on the gross value, not your equity.

16–24

Months of Delay

The average California probate takes 16 to 24 months. During this time, your family cannot access accounts, sell property, or distribute assets.

100%

Public Record

Everything filed in probate court becomes public record: your assets, your debts, your family details. Anyone can see it.

Guardianship & Family Protection

Name the guardian you trust for your children. Protect their inheritance. Make sure your family is cared for according to your wishes, not left to a court's default.

Living Trusts & Wills

A properly funded living trust keeps your home and assets out of probate and passes everything directly to your loved ones privately, quickly, and at a fraction of the cost.

Special Needs Trusts

Provide lifelong support for a loved one with special needs without jeopardizing their government benefits. Carefully drafted for California requirements.
